移動產品基礎模塊設計規范之注冊登錄
移動產品基礎模塊設計規范會是一個系列,將會不定期為大家帶來我自己工作中的一些分析和總結。那么我們就開始吧—— 因為我們的產品在優化注冊登錄(這里指的注冊登錄時比較寬泛的,而不是具體的形態),因此總結下自己在做主持登錄時候的一些思考問題: 1. 是否需要在打開app的時候就需要登錄? 2. 還是在需要填寫收貨信息或發表評論時才需要登錄? 3. 登錄的時候最方便的是用QQ、微信、微博進行聯合登錄,但是聯合登錄后是否還需要用戶再輸入手機號賬號等注冊性質信息? 4. 如果一定要用戶重新注冊,或者是為了驗證有效身份的話,怎么做? 5. 密碼輸入時是否使用明文? 6. 密碼等安全性的考慮,建議后置,即給用戶最輕松設置過程,如,可以讓用戶設置 6 位數字的登錄密碼,如何保障用戶賬戶的安全?通過登錄次數、地點、操作去設置規則,不要在注冊的時候難為用戶; 7. 驗證碼什么的,一定是在用戶使用同一設備注冊多次,等“刷(一個設備登錄多個賬號)”行為時才需要用戶輸入,在正常情況下一定給用戶最輕松的體驗,什么密碼安全性、驗證碼都是遇到不正常用戶才使用的招數,那么不正常用戶一定有特征,在制定特征下在放招,不然非常容易殺死大批普通用戶; 8. 注冊完/登錄完一定要直接切回需要登錄的流程節點中么? 9. 用戶為什么要登錄,以及為什么需要用戶登錄?(用戶角度以及產品功能角度考慮) 10. 手機號+密碼注冊、手機號+短信驗證碼注冊、郵箱注冊、第三方賬戶注冊,你會選哪些?(注冊登錄方式) 11. 用戶未登錄下和已登錄下,他們的訪問權限會有什么不同?(用戶訪問權限) 12. 用戶注冊后是直接進入應用,還是需要填寫個人信息?(用戶信息完善) 不同場景下,用戶注冊登錄的方式是否不同,或者相同?(場景化) 13. 需要給用戶提示注冊登錄原因么?不登錄會損失什么?為什么提示,何時提示以及如何提示?(登錄理由) 首先,什么是注冊登錄? 你需要一個授權,來做一些你平常狀態下無法完成的事。本質上,注冊登錄是授權功能,用戶獲得授權后次啊能使用產品的某些功能,或是查看產品內的某些內容。理論上產品內的每一個功能或每一份內容都有自己的權限設定,例如:管理員可操作,收費用戶可查看,有Cookie即可操作等等。 注冊登錄看起來簡單,但實際上卻是很復雜的。注冊登錄需要考慮產品類型、所處的場景、以及用戶行為等不同因素。 有個面試題,不也是通過登錄注冊來考察候選人的么?(很奇怪為什么會選用這個角度?大家誰面試的時候遇到過呢?) 其次,用戶為什么需要注冊登錄? 講真,真心不是太喜歡各種登錄,如果可以,真的能不加就不加!能不加就不加!能不加就不加! 從用戶的角度來講,一切分散用戶注意力的操作,都是不被允許的。不過注冊登錄能夠保障用戶的個人隱私,滿足用戶的虛榮心,也能幫助用戶記錄的行為, 也會使得用戶能夠與其他用戶建立關系,從而更好的為用戶提供服務。整體來說,大概有這幾點用戶層面的考慮。 從功能層面上講,便于用跨平臺使用賬號,而不會受到限制。對于社交功能的移動產品來說,注冊登錄賬號才能發布內容,方便用戶同步個人信息,讓用戶的辨識度增強。對于電商等類型,有交易功能的產品來說,能夠記錄用戶的訂單以及流轉狀態,還能提高安全性。對于游戲等應用內付費、會員等增值功能的產品來說,注冊除了能保證安全性之外,還能同步用戶的等級、狀態等。 從業務層面上講,用戶注冊登錄,能夠給核心業務提供用戶信息,比如手機號、用戶姓名、性別等統計學意義的數據和信息。也能夠采集到更多的運營數據,幫助商務和運營部門,指導工作方向,比如用戶地域、教育水平、收入等。還能夠反饋并完善產品的用戶體系。最后,也是能更好的促進和新業務的提升,比如消費轉化等。 需要綜合目標用戶的使用習慣和產品業務需求兩方面考慮。對于用戶來說最合理的辦法是提供多種可選的注冊方式,給用戶多樣化的選擇。但考慮到業務需要和開發成本等因素,根據業務需要和目標用戶習慣可以篩選最適合的注冊方式。 接著,了解登錄注冊的方式以及利弊 不知道大家有沒有考慮過,目前大部分人,或者說你的目標群體會使用什么樣的方式和條件注冊登錄?這么做的成本有哪些?是不是還有更簡單的方式? 在上面的文字中,我提到了一些注冊登錄的方式,在這部分中,我們講具體看一下注冊登錄的方式以及利弊。 我自己整理了一下,大概有四大類型,8 種注冊方式,主要是: 手機號注冊 郵箱注冊 第三方授權 游客模式 1. 手機號注冊,手機號注冊是目前主流的注冊方式。 手機號碼+密碼注冊(已有的能力) 手機號碼+驗證碼注冊(我們后來補充了這一種方式,但是后來遇到問題了,正在調整) 手機號碼+密碼+驗證碼注冊(已有的能力) 手機號+密碼+昵稱(昵稱驗證識別) 驗證注冊方式:短信、語音等 其特點是便于記憶,短信驗證碼方便快捷,操作流程體驗比較好?;谥悄苁謾C的普及,大眾用戶在操作方式上沒有任何障礙。另外,這種方式還能直接獲取用戶手機號這個重要信息,便于一些業務的展開。 另外一點就是,手機號+驗證碼注冊,從成本上考慮也是與必要的,畢竟一條短信幾分錢呢,對于創業公司來說,還是要注意的,推薦手機號+密碼的登錄方式! 手機號注冊的邏輯就是錄入手機號碼后,發起短信驗證的請求,當手機收到相應的短信驗證碼后,在APP中輸入驗證碼,完成注冊。 基于以上的邏輯,不同的APP會有不同的設計細節。 比如一些APP將所有操作放入一個頁面中,比如一些APP會分成:錄入手機號->短信驗證->設置密碼三個頁面來完成。 也有一些直接設計成利用手機號和短信驗證碼登錄的“短信快速登錄”,省去了設置密碼的環節,加快了注冊的速度。由于邏輯基本相同,這些方式實際流程上差別不是很大。 2. 郵箱注冊 郵箱地址+密碼注冊 相對于手機號注冊,郵箱注冊的好處在于郵箱地址可以永久留存,不會有手機換號造成的那種困擾。但是其缺點也比較多: 對于國內用戶來說,郵箱的使用頻率沒有國外那么高,郵箱的重要性遠低于QQ、微信、微博、手機等。很多用戶沒有個人郵箱,他們也不會為了注冊你的賬戶去申請個郵箱,所以郵箱注冊的需求相對來說較弱。 在移動端利用郵箱注冊的體驗也較差,因為驗證郵箱的話需要跳出APP去接收郵件,無論是登錄郵件客戶端還是打開瀏覽器進入郵箱網頁,這個操作都提高了流程的復雜度,降低了用戶體驗。 那么,郵箱注冊是否還有存在的價值?為什么還有一些應用保留了郵箱注冊功能(或只提供了郵箱注冊功能)呢?個人分析有四點原因: APP的用戶群體不只國內用戶,考慮到外國人的使用習慣,保留了郵箱注冊。 一些商務類的APP,用戶群體鎖定為職場人士,這些人是有郵箱的使用習慣的。 一些學習類的APP,考慮到學生群體換號的可能性比較大(或出國)。 考慮到一些不希望暴露自己手機號,不愿意用手機號注冊的用戶群體。 3. 第三方賬戶授權登錄 國內常見的有微信、微博、QQ三個社交平臺的授權登錄,國外常見的還有Facebook、Twitter、Google等平臺。 下面分析一下利用第三方賬戶登錄的優缺點: 優點1:為用戶節省注冊時間,簡單點擊兩下就可以直接登陸。體驗最佳。(不包括微博認證總出錯的問題) 優點2:利用第三方平臺注冊過的用戶,都是經過手機或郵箱驗證過的用戶,安全可靠。同時引入第三方賬戶的方式也將賬戶安全性的問題拋給了第三方平臺。 優點3:利用第三方賬戶登錄,可以在條件允許下獲取第三方平臺的信息,比如好友信息、基礎資料等信息。 缺點:只利用第三方賬戶登錄的話,無法獲得任何有價值的用戶注冊信息,同時也構建不成自己的用戶體系。這是第三方賬戶登錄的最大問題。 4. 游客登錄 這種登錄方式多見于一些允許用戶瀏覽應用信息的應用,以及游戲類應用中。 接著,注冊登錄的規劃 先請大家看一個我們的界面,看看其中有哪些元素: 從規劃中,可以看出,這個登錄界面(打個廣告哦:這是我們的應用 美著呢,1.2 的登錄界面規劃;馬上就發 1.1 版啦,預計五一期間更新,歡迎大家來下載體驗!)中有登錄(手機號+密碼)、找回密碼、短信驗證碼登錄,以及底部的注冊以及微信登錄。 基本的布局方式是:登錄-注冊兩大塊,把第三方授權和新戶注冊放到一起,主要因為他們同屬于新增用戶一列,并且優先搶到新戶注冊,弱化了第三方授權登錄。 大家可以多參照一些應用的登錄、注冊、短信驗證碼登錄、找回密碼等界面,來做整理分析,這樣會對這部分的認識更加深刻。 再來看,細節,細節,細節 1. 注冊 手機號顯示方式:132********,還是132 **** ****(3-4-4式,或者其他) 手機號占用判斷 驗證碼獲取時間(一般60秒,我們設置了一個300秒,唉~~) 驗證碼長度(4或6位) 驗證碼重復獲?。ǔ^獲取時長,在時長內如何提示?) 郵箱占用判斷 郵箱合法性驗證 郵箱自動聯想 郵箱激活驗證郵件(驗證地址以及重發功能) 用戶名占用判斷 密碼構成規則 是否需要確認輸入密碼(需要:兩次輸入,不需要) 密碼是否顯示明文(默認顯示,默認不顯示) 第三方授權登錄后是否需要完善個人信息? 完善時機? 用戶信息完善時機 2. 登錄和退出 2.1 獨立登錄 2.1.1 手機號碼登錄 手機號+密碼 登錄 手機號+驗證碼 登錄(驗證鏈接有效時間、重發功能) cookie信息+密碼 登錄 cookie信息+驗證碼 登錄(驗證鏈接有效時間、重發功能) 2.1.2 郵箱登錄 郵箱地址+密碼 登錄 cookie信息+密碼 登錄 2.1.3 用戶名登錄 用戶名+密碼 登錄 cookie信息+密碼 登錄 2.2 異常情況 2.2.1 忘記密碼 忘記登錄密碼: 輸入手機號驗證找回密碼 注冊郵箱郵件找回密碼 安全問題找回密碼 安全郵箱找回密碼 2.2.2 忘記登錄ID 找回登錄ID:綁定郵箱找回;綁定手機找回 更換登錄方式 2.2.3 忘記登錄ID和密碼 綁定手機號找回ID 綁定郵箱找回ID 綁定安全郵箱找回ID 2.3 第三方授權登錄 國內:微信、QQ、微博,其他 國外:Facebook、Twitter,其他 2.4 退出登錄 退出登錄后是否記錄手機號、郵箱cookie 再次打開應用登錄時,是否記錄手機號、郵箱cookie 記錄cookie的時長是多少 同理,用戶名是否記錄? 用戶名是否與手機號、郵箱賬號關聯 2.5 其他 如何更換手機號、郵箱? 是否存在解綁綁定手機號、第三方賬號 如何綜合靈活利用幾種登錄方式? 結語 注冊登錄并不是一件小事,要認真對待! 補充 1. 是“登錄”,還是“登陸”? 登錄與登陸,相信有很多人會將兩個詞用錯或者混淆,我們先來看看辭海的解釋: 登陸,渡過海洋或江河登上陸地。特指作戰的軍隊由水面登上敵方的陸地。Land 之意,后來引申為著陸之意。以前說上網,是網上沖浪。早期是網頁時代,只需要點擊鏈接看頁面上的內容即可。那時候還沒有注冊會員。所以,這個時期的網上沖浪,即為登陸網站,到達了網站。不用進行輸入注冊賬號和密碼等操作即可瀏覽公開的信息。 登錄,列入、記載。登記記錄用戶輸入的注冊賬號和密碼。技術層面上解釋更準確,即用戶輸入注冊賬號和密碼的時候,數據進行記錄核對的過程,錄入成功后,則登錄成功。登錄,則存在表層和底層的信息登記和記錄核對的過程。登錄成功后,才算正在進入網站或者應用,可以查看登陸時看不到的內容或者信息。 如果是你,你會選哪個呢?我,還是堅持“登錄”! 為什么不用英文“Login”、“Logout”呢?這多清楚啊~ 2. 登錄的時機 除以下幾種情況,建議先讓用戶使用再注冊: 應用功能限制必須先注冊的,比如QQ、微信等社交軟件 用戶有強烈使用意愿使用的產品,比如口碑非常高的、階段性的爆款、能讓用戶占到便宜的。 某特定業務原因需要優先注冊的。 3. 注冊登錄向前思考 產品的行業屬性,我們的產品到底是款什么產品? 公司想拿到用戶的什么數據?用戶愿意給我們什么樣的數據和信息? 后期運營商務的需要等 本文由人人都是產品經理專欄作家 @鄭幾塊 授權發布于人人都是產品經理?。未經許可,禁止轉載。
- 目前還沒評論,等你發揮!